23 Henry St is an apartment community located in Broome County and the 13901 ZIP Code.
Center City is also known as Downtown Binghamton and sits in the heart of town at the confluence of the Susquehanna and Chenango Rivers. This historic district offers an array of restaurants, entertainment, and attractions like NYSEG Stadium, home to the Binghamton Mets. Residents enjoy grabbing a bite to eat at the Colonial on Court Street or Garage Taco Bar on Washington Street. Center City is also home to local businesses, breweries, bars, and specialty shops. Apartments in Center City range from affordable to upscale, so there’s something for everyone in this downtown district.
